Creating an Effective Maintenance Schedule for Your S810RL Sterilight UV Lamp

Maintaining the performance of your ultraviolet (UV) water treatment system is vital for ensuring the ongoing safety and purity of your water supply. The S810RL Sterilight lamp is designed to deliver consistent UV disinfection for systems processing up to 8 gallons per minute. To keep your system operating effectively, establishing a regular maintenance schedule and understanding the appropriate replacement procedures for the UV lamp are essential components of system upkeep.

When to Replace Your UV Lamp

UV lamps like the S810RL gradually decrease in output over time. This decline can reduce the lamp's ability to effectively inactivate microorganisms in your water. As a general guideline, the lamp should be replaced approximately every 12 months of use. Regular monitoring through UV intensity checks can help determine if replacement should be performed sooner, especially if UV light output is significantly diminished. Consistent replacement ensures your system continues to provide reliable microbial control and maintains water clarity.

Developing a Routine Maintenance Schedule

A proactive maintenance routine involves regular inspection, cleaning, and timely replacement of parts. The following steps can serve as a framework for maintaining your UV system:

  • Monthly Inspection: Visually examine the lamp and surrounding components for signs of wear or deposits. Clean the quartz sleeve gently as needed to remove any buildup that may hinder UV transmission.
  • Quarterly Checks: Confirm that the UV systems power supply and indicator lights are functioning properly. Check for any alerts or warning signals from the system.
  • Annual Replacement: Replace the UV lamp after approximately 12 months of continuous use or if UV intensity measurements indicate diminished performance. Always follow the manufacturer's guidelines and use compatible replacement lamps designed for your system.

Best Practices for Lamp Replacement

When replacing your UV lamp, ensure the new lamp is installed correctly to maximize its disinfecting capability. Turn off the power supply before removing the old lamp to prevent accidental injury or system damage. Handle the lamp carefully by its ends to avoid contamination or damage to the glass. After installation, reset any system timers or indicators and verify proper operation through system status checks. Proper disposal of the used lamp is recommended according to local regulations.

Additional Tips for Maintaining Water Quality

Beyond lamp maintenance, check your entire water treatment system periodically to ensure all components are functioning optimally. Replace filters as per the manufacturers recommendations and keep the system clean to support UV efficacy. Combining regular maintenance and timely consumable replacement will help sustain the water systems ability to deliver clean, safe water efficiently and reliably.

Questions worth asking before buying

Before committing to a water treatment system, it is important to establish specific criteria to ensure it meets your household’s needs. Start by assessing your water quality through testing to determine which contaminants must be addressed. This foundational knowledge will help identify the appropriate treatment system for your circumstances. Consider factors such as your daily water usage, the number of household members, and any known issues with your current supply.

It is also advisable to inquire about the maintenance requirements of the system, including how often parts need replacement and the ease of acquiring consumables like filters. Understanding the long-term upkeep can inform your decision-making process. Lastly, evaluate the warranty and customer support options available. These considerations will help you choose a reliable solution that aligns with your lifestyle and ensures ongoing water safety.
